About

Chang Seon Ryu is a scholar working on Molecular Biology, Health, Toxicology and Mutagenesis and Pharmacology. According to data from OpenAlex, Chang Seon Ryu has authored 39 papers receiving a total of 741 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Molecular Biology, 12 papers in Health, Toxicology and Mutagenesis and 11 papers in Pharmacology. Recurrent topics in Chang Seon Ryu's work include Pharmacogenetics and Drug Metabolism (8 papers), Effects and risks of endocrine disrupting chemicals (8 papers) and Pharmaceutical and Antibiotic Environmental Impacts (5 papers). Chang Seon Ryu is often cited by papers focused on Pharmacogenetics and Drug Metabolism (8 papers), Effects and risks of endocrine disrupting chemicals (8 papers) and Pharmaceutical and Antibiotic Environmental Impacts (5 papers). Chang Seon Ryu collaborates with scholars based in South Korea, Germany and Finland. Chang Seon Ryu's co-authors include Sang Kyum Kim, Kathrin Klein, Ulrich M. Zanger, Young Jun Kim, Soo Jin Oh, Jung Min Oh, Keon Wook Kang, Baeckkyoung Sung, Jong Min Choi and Sang Yoon Lee and has published in prestigious journals such as Food Chemistry, Chemical Engineering Journal and Small.
